Created in 2002 by GSA's Environmental Strategies and Safety Division, the Construction Waste Management Database is a free online service for those seeking information on companies that haul, collect, and process debris from construction projects. To assist users, the database allows searches by state and zip code, and by more than 15 commonly-recycled construction waste materials.
In 2004, GSA updated its online database to assist the building industry in reducing construction and demolition waste. Recyclers of construction and demolition waste may now advertise their services free on the site.
The database is currently housed on the
Whole Building Design Guide, a Web-based portal providing government and industry practitioners with one-stop access to information on a wide range of building-related guidance, criteria, and technology.
